Progress (Nasdaq: PRGS) is looking to support customer marketing initiatives for MarkLogic and Semaphore—two cornerstone data and semantic solutions in the Progress Data Platform by bringing customer success stories to life, strengthening advocacy programs, and supporting lifecycle marketing campaigns that drive adoption, retention, and expansion.

Requirements

  • Exposure to data, analytics, or AI-driven software solutions.
  • Familiarity with customer advocacy, lifecycle, or community marketing programs.
  • Comfort working with cross-functional technical and marketing teams in a global organization.
  • Demonstrable AI skills in the development of content creation and sales aids.

Responsibilities

  • Support the execution of customer marketing programs that celebrate customer success and increase product adoption.
  • Help create customer-facing assets—case studies, testimonials, success videos, and spotlights—showcasing measurable impact and ROI.
  • Maintain and update the customer advocacy library and assist in coordinating customer participation in references, events, and analyst briefings.
  • Conduct basic data and sentiment analysis on customer engagement metrics to inform future programs.
  • Draft and edit content for newsletters, webinars, and community features highlighting customer innovation and outcomes.
  • Collaborate cross-functionally to ensure consistent messaging and storytelling across campaigns and platforms.
  • Partner with Customer Success, Product Marketing, and Demand Generation to assist with retention and expansion campaigns.

Other

  • 1–3 years of marketing experience—preferably in product marketing, customer marketing, or a related B2B SaaS/software marketing role.
  • Strong writing and storytelling skills with a customer-centric mindset.
  • Detail-oriented, proactive, and comfortable managing multiple projects in a fast-paced environment.
  • Bachelor’s degree in marketing, communications, business, engineering or a related field.
  • Analytical and curious, eager to use data and feedback to guide program improvements.
